Design Engineer
Professional Technical Ltd Coventry, Warwickshire
A market leader in consumer electronics is looking to recruit a Design Engineer to join their product development team. Based in Warwickshire, you will benefit from a starting salary of up to 35k plus benefits and excellent career opportunities. As Design Engineer, responsibilities will include; Designing and developing sustainable products, components, and systems that align with the company's environmental and customer-focused goals. Leading product validation and testing to ensure performance, safety, and reliability. Staying ahead of industry trends and integrating emerging technologies and practices into design processes. Ensuring all designs comply with relevant regulations and meet required performance standards. Creating comprehensive manufacturing documentation, including detailed drawings and engineering Bills of Materials (BOMs). Delivering cost-effective and functionally sound design solutions within project constraints. Supporting the wider engineering team with additional tasks as needed. Key skills needed for the Design Engineer: A degree in Mechanical Engineering, a BTEC Higher National Certificate (or equivalent), or completion of an engineering apprenticeship. Proven ability to solve complex problems and develop sustainable design solutions. Experience working with plastic materials in product design. Proficiency in 3D CAD software (SolidWorks preferred). Strong working knowledge of Microsoft Office applications. Ability to produce clear, concise technical reports. As Design Engineer, you will receive an excellent benefits package which includes: Up to 35,000 basic salary. Contributory pension. 25 days holiday + bank holidays. On-site subsidised restaurant. Free car parking. Excellent career opportunities. This is a great opportunity to join a fast-paced growing business with excellent progression opportunities. Graduates will be considered with some relevant work experience post-graduation.

Electrical & Controls Technician
Mars
Job Description: Electrical & Controls Technician -Mars Petcare Melton Mowbray £51,900- £56,000 (including shift allowances, DOE) + Performance Bonus & Exceptional Benefits Shift pattern 12 Hrs - 7-7, 2 days, 2 nights, 4 off Why Join Us? At Melton, we're at the forefront of innovation in high-speed food processing, and we're searching for a talented Electrical & Controls Technician to join our team. This isn't just another job - it's your chance to make an impact, grow your expertise, and work with cutting-edge technology in a fast-paced, dynamic environment. Cutting-Edge Tech: Work with advanced systems like ABB/Kuka robotics, Allen Bradley PLCs, and predictive maintenance tools. Supportive Culture: Be part of a team that values innovation, continuous improvement, and collaboration. The Role We have an opportunity for an Electrical & Controls Technician to join and be responsible for the efficient, safe, and reliable operating condition of complex process and high-speed food processing equipment. The role will mainly focus on providing equipment troubleshooting and breakdown maintenance. As troubleshooting requirements are accomplished, the technician will change focus toward preventive maintenance activities. Systematically repair, adjust, and maintain processing, filling, conveying, and packaging machinery using established maintenance reliability practices, consistent observation, repair, and follow-up of operational effectiveness. Other duties include participating in continuous improvement teams, working on new project activities and continuous training. Shift Pattern - 12 Hours • 2 Days: 7am-7pm • 2 Nights: 7pm-7am and then repeat. What's in it for you? Competitive salary £51,900- £56,000 (including shift allowances, DOE) Hot food restaurant on site Career growth opportunities with structured development & Mars University Private healthcare + equal parental leave Generous pension (up to 9% contribution) Life assurance (4x salary) EV salary sacrifice scheme Gym membership & wellbeing support Annual leave starting at 24 days, rising to 32 with service Free parking on site What We're Looking For Practical electrical engineering skills gained through HNC/HND (NVQ Level 4 apprenticeship or equivalent) and BS7671, or comparable hands-on experience in a technical field. Understanding of precision instrumentation-including repair and calibration-or experience with similar technical equipment. Mindset: Strong problem-solving abilities, curiosity, and a drive to improve processes and efficiency. Ability to adapt to various electrical power supplies and control systems, with a willingness to learn new technologies and approaches to equipment maintenance and troubleshooting. Experience in troubleshooting and maintaining automated or electromechanical machinery, or a background in related fields such as industrial maintenance, robotics, or process engineering, with exposure to automation concepts. Key Responsibilities Maintain, troubleshoot, test, and modify automated and electromechanical equipment, applying transferable skills from related technical roles. Apply engineering principles-drawing on both mechanical and electrical knowledge-to resolve production issues and enhance efficiency and reliability. Develop, track, and communicate maintenance metrics to identify, reduce, and eliminate recurring equipment issues, contributing to improved system reliability. Participate in continuous improvement initiatives (such as Lean Manufacturing or Kaizen), bringing fresh perspectives from previous roles or industries. Conduct Root Cause Failure Analysis on major breakdowns and recurring problems, using analytical skills and experience from any technical problem-solving environment. What You Can Expect from Mars Work alongside 130,000+ Associates worldwide guided by our Five Principles Be part of a purpose-driven company shaping "the world we want tomorrow" Access world-class training & development from day one Join a company with an industry-leading salary and benefits package

Business Information Security Officer
Elsevier City, London
.Business Information Security Officer page is loaded Business Information Security Officerlocations: UK - London (London Wall)time type: Full timeposted on: Posted Todayjob requisition id: R104056 About our Team This team delivers outcomes, longer-term improvements and benefits that are measurable and impact the achievement of organization goals. This includes managing complex and critical issues, creating strategies and charting a course for cyber progress. About the Role As a BISO for our A&G or TIO markets, you will be responsible for planning, organizing, and executing enterprise-wide information and security initiatives. You will deliver long-term improvements and benefits impacting our organizational goals focusing on risk management and cybersecurity defences. Responsibilities Driving information, cyber and infrastructure security awareness and governance deep into the organization. This will involve aligning Business & Technology units with enterprise cybersecurity programs and objectives Providing a critical liaison role between the business unit and the Elsevier Cyber Security organization. This includes enhancing the level of collaboration and effective communications with key stakeholders/business units. Managing the oversight of technical risk assessments, such as vulnerability scanning, penetration testing, risk reviews for new applications, and third-party risk assessments. Leading, monitoring and managing security projects; provide expert guidance on security matters for other IT projects. Defining the information and infrastructure security utilizing a risk-based approach. Develop goals, training recommendations, strategies, plans, and success criteria needed to achieve the vision Developing and report cyber security metric scorecards to reflect the level of adoption and compliance to security policies/standards. Tasked with the remediation of vulnerabilities, and residual risks. Managing the oversight of technical risk assessments, such as vulnerability scanning, penetration testing, risk reviews for new applications. Leading, monitoring and managing security projects; provide expert guidance on security matters for other IT projects Providing leadership and direction for the integration of security strategy and architecture with business and IT strategy. Evaluate and design the implementation of new or updated information security hardware or software. Analyse its impact on the existing environment. Requirements You will have experience as a BISO for several years. As a BISO, you can show strong collaboration and communication skills with technical teams like security, infrastructure, operations, and software engineering. You will have expertise in Cyber Security, including incident response, risk management, and governance, by developing innovative strategies and security programs. Demonstrate extensive understanding of Information Security compliance and governance frameworks such as ISO27001. You will have extensive experience in problem-solving involving leading teams in identifying, researching, and coordinating the resources necessary to effectively. Senior Logistics Manager
Sumaria Systems, Inc. Bedford, Bedfordshire
Overview Sumaria prides itself on delivering efficient and effective solutions across a wide range of industries. Our success depends on the stellar ability of our Logistics Managers. We are currently searching for an experienced Senior Logistics Manager to join our ranks and continue this tradition. The ideal candidate has the knowledge, experience and demonstrated ability to perform tasks related to the technical/professional discipline they are performing. Typically works independently and applies the proper procedures and processes related to their area of expertise. Has the ability to problem solve and troubleshoot various situations to develop successful outcomes within established program / project guidelines. Work is performed independently or under the oversight of more senior contractor employees. To join our dynamic, professional team, review our list of jobs below to find the one that is the perfect fit for you. If none of these are right for you right now, submit your application to the general consideration posting. Responsibilities Identify the specific requirements for money, manpower, materiel, facilities, and services needed to support the program; and correlating those requirements with program plans to assure that the needed support is provided at the right time and place Collaborate with material support managers and product support manager to maintain comprehensive support plans (including sister service and coalition service coordination) Participate in the development of maintenance and life cycle logistics plans to ensure smooth product transition to air logistics complex centers Develop and executes logistics and sustainment plans Identify and help mitigate sustainment problem areas, specifically on CDA Coordinate and evaluate the efforts of functional specialists to identify specific requirements and to develop and adjust plans and schedules for the actions needed to meet each requirement on time Perform clerical/administrative/office operations support Provide logistics analytical support for key logistics metrics, including but not limited to supply, reliability, maintainability, and provide them in key logistics reviews Assist with planning, evaluation and implementation of program acquisition and sustainment strategies to meet DoD 5000.2 guidance Develop program management documentation to support all phases of the acquisition and sustainment life cycle Develop briefings to support acquisition decision milestones and sustainment planning efforts Provide expert logistics inputs to Request for Proposal (RFPs) including systems specs, Electronic Warfare Systems (SRDs), Statement of Work (SOWs), and Contract Data Requirements List (CDRLs), and other RFP products Assist with development of program office estimates, financial and research reports, and other financial management studies, analysis, and reports as required Develop logistics planning documents to include, but not limited to, Life Cycle Sustainment Plans (LCSPs), weapon system delivery and deployment plans (integrated and optimized across Developmental System Manager (DSM) production and delivery schedules and System Program Manager (SPM)/Depot induction/modification plans and schedules), Integrated Logistics Support Plans (ILSPs), Product Support Business Case Analyses, Depot Source of Repair (DSOR)/ Source of Repair Assignment (SORA) packages, and Diminishing Manufacturing Sources plans, including research and identification of alternative components where required; employ supply chain, program dashboards and other state of art data analysis to ensure necessary level of asset visibility; provide other logistics studies, analyses, and reports as required. Support development of system technical trade studies and other documentation for integration, upgrade, and modification efforts; aircraft integration may be included. Provide independent analysis of system readiness for production and risk management purposes Support other engineering studies, analyses, and other engineering studies, analyses, and reports as required Support Test and Evaluation (T&E) Strategies (TES); Integrated Test Team (ITT) Charters; TEMPs; and other unique T&E products as needed. Provide other T&E studies, analysis, and reports as required Assist with Capability Based Assessments (CBAs), Initial Capability Documents (ICDs), Capability Development Documents (CDDs), and Capability Production Documents (CPDs), along with associated risk assessments, briefings and coordination/staffing documentation Maintain Requirements Traceability, and develop required reports and analyses, to facilitate updates to existing CDDs, and CPDs as required by senior government decision makers Support development of Net-Ready Key Performance Parameter (NR-KPP) documentation, Information Support Plans (ISPs), Information Assurance Support plans (IASPs), Program Protection Plans (PPPs), and any/all related DoD Architecture Framework 2.2 (or later) architecture views Assist with other developmental planning studies, analysis, and reports as required Assist the Government in performing source selection tasks, to include but not limited to, recommending evaluation areas, factors, sub-factors, elements and criteria; developing and administering source selection documentation; develop and analyze acquisition strategies; draft, review and finalize reports, summaries, memorandums and briefings necessary to the source selection process Required Skills and Education Experience in integrating the separate functions in planning, implementing or executing a logistics management program Experience with the acquisition lifecycle and product support planning during each phase or milestone Experience with defense acquisition management processes in accordance with the DoD 5000 series instructions Experience with the DoD integrated product support element structure Familiarity with the Product Support Business Case Analysis (PS-BCA), Life Cycle Sustainment Plan (LCSP), and Logistics Health Assessment (LHA) processes Knowledge of the DoD Product Support Manager Guidebook Knowledge of agency program planning, funding, and management information systems Broad knowledge of the organization and functions of activities involved in providing logistical support Education and Qualifications Education- Master's or Doctorate Degree in a related field and at least 10 years of experience in the respective technical / professional discipline being performed, 5 years of which must be in the DoD OR, Bachelor's Degree in a related field and 12 years of experience in the respective technical/professional discipline being performed, 5 years of which must be in the DoD OR, 15 years of directly related experience, 8 years of which must be in the DoD. Travel: Yes Security Clearance Required: Secret Position Type: Full Time Work Location: Hanscom AFB, MA (Hybrid) Top salaries paid for qualified candidates. Sumaria is an equal opportunity employer and considers qualified applicants for employment without regard to race, color, creed, religion, national origin,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ity and expression, age, disability, or protected veteran status. Sumaria is a Full Lifecycle Engineering, Technical Services and Professional Solutions company in support of the Warfighter, supporting modernization, high end services and next generation capabilities in contested domains. Sumaria has been a trusted partner to U. S. Department of Defense for more than 40 years, providing Lifecycle Systems Engineering, Advisory & Analysis/SETA, C5ISR and Enterprise Information Technology solutions. With expertise to lead, insight to deliver and commitment to succeed; we staff each mission with a carefully selected team of seasoned professionals. We're Headquartered in Peabody, MA, and have regional offices across the nation. Maintenance Excellence Manager
Muller UK & Ireland Bellshill, Lanarkshire
Who we are We're Müller UK & Ireland, a family-run dairy business and we're experts at what we do. Dairy is a key part of a healthy and balanced diet and we're super proud to help meet the nutritional needs of millions of people, every, single, day. To do this, our business has been split into two areas: Müller Milk & Ingredients (MMI) and Müller Yogurt & Desserts (MYD). Join MMI and step into a culture that's fast-paced and full of opportunity. With great benefits, exciting challenges, a dream team of people, this is your chance to make a real impact. Over here, we're processing enough milk to make 66 billion cups of tea every year. And we're so much more than just milk. This is the place to come for cream, butter, milk drinks and ingredients products (a lot, we know), all made from milk from over 1,000 supplying farmers in Britain. Why Müller? Milk flows through everything at Müller - from farm to factory to fridge. But the true impact comes from our people, in each and every corner of the business, working hard and as a team to put smiles on faces everywhere, making each day delicious for our shoppers. As the UK's most popular dairy brand, we're always striving to make a real difference for our planet, our partners and our people, making sure we're helping to create a more sustainable dairy future. We're growing to keep up with the millions of people reaching for our branded and private label products on shelves everywhere. Join a culture full of pace that's bold and entrepreneurial, with opportunities that are yours for the taking - and even enjoy every benefit and bonus to sweeten the deal. Join Müller as a Maintenance Excellence Manager Location: Bellshill Dairy Contract Type: Permanent, full time, Monday - Friday Salary: Competitive + Excellent Benefits We're excited to offer this opportunity as we look to the future, our current Maintenance Excellence Manager is moving on to new ventures outside the business, and we're now seeking a passionate and driven individual to carry forward the strong legacy they've built. About the Role As our Maintenance Excellence Manager, you'll be at the forefront of delivering value through world-class asset care. You'll lead the implementation of our Maintenance Excellence Roadmap, champion reliability and performance improvements, and embed a culture of continuous improvement across our engineering teams. Key Responsibilities Lead the annual Maintenance Excellence implementation plan Drive critical engineering processes and reliability-centred maintenance (RCM) Champion root cause analysis and top-loss performance improvement Enhance CMMS usage and inventory management strategies Support Autonomous Maintenance and 5S initiatives Facilitate RCM workshops and develop standard routines for critical equipment Collaborate across teams to deliver cost-effective maintenance solutions Promote a strong safety culture and operational excellence mindset What You'll Bring Proven experience in maintenance leadership within a manufacturing or FMCG environment Strong knowledge of CMMS systems (e.g., SAP, Movex, Mainsaver) Expertise in RCA, FMECA, and lean methodologies Excellent people management and coaching skills A passion for continuous improvement and innovation Ability to influence and collaborate across functions and levels Why Join Us? At Müller, we don't just make dairy products, we make careers. You'll be part of a forward-thinking team that values innovation, leadership, and personal growth. We offer: A supportive and inclusive culture Tailored development programmes including Fit for Leadership and Lean Manager training Opportunities to lead impactful projects and shape the future of maintenance excellence Competitive salary and benefits package 4 x life assurance 33 days holiday (inclusive of bank holidays) Private medical insurance Up to 10% annual bonus Annual salary reviews Ready to lead the future of maintenance excellence? Network Operations Manager
Muller UK & Ireland Market Drayton, Shropshire
Müller UK & Ireland is wholly owned by Unternehmensgruppe Theo Müller which employs over 31,000 people throughout Europe. In the UK, Müller develops, manufactures and markets a wide range of branded and private label dairy products made with milk from 1,300 farmers in Britain.Müller is ranked within the top 20 in The Grocer's Top 100 list of Britain's Biggest Brands and is picked from shelves millions of times each year. Müller UK & Ireland includes: Müller Milk & Ingredients which aims to be Britain's private label dairy leader and produces branded and private label fresh milk, cream, butter and ingredients products. It boasts a network of dairies and depots servicing customers throughout the country. Müller Yogurt & Desserts which is the UK's leading yogurt manufacturer which aims to create millions more Müller moments for its consumers. It is responsible for major brands like Müller Corner, Müllerlight, Müller Bliss, Müller Rice, FRijj and Müller Kefir Smoothie and produces chilled desserts under licence from Mondelez International. It also supplies the UK private label yogurt market from a dedicated, state of the art yogurt facility. Are you ready to unleash your potential and build an exciting career in finance with Britian's most chosen dairy brand? Müller UK & Ireland, part of the renowned Unternehmensgruppe Theo Müller, invites you to apply for our Network Operations Manager position. With over 31,000 employees across Europe and a long-standing commitment to excellence, Müller is a family-owned business known for its dedication to quality, innovation, and growth. In the UK alone, we produce a wide range of leading branded and private-label dairy products, from yogurts and desserts to butter and flavoured milk. As our Network Operations Manager, you will: Lead a high-performing team of infrastructure analysts, overseeing the design, maintenance, and continuous improvement of enterprise IT systems. This role combines strategic oversight with hands-on leadership, ensuring reliable, scalable, and secure infrastructure that supports our 24/7 manufacturing operations. Leading a talented team, you will shape the backbone of our IT operations, and make a real impact on a fast-paced, innovative organization. What You'll Do: •Lead, mentor, and develop a talented team of engineers and network specialists. •Drive infrastructure strategy, roadmaps, and initiatives aligned with business goals. •Ensure reliability, security, and scalability across on-premises and cloud environments. •Oversee infrastructure projects, upgrades, vendor management, and cost control. •Foster cross-functional collaboration and maintain compliance with industry standards. What We're Looking For: •Strong technical expertise in networks, data centers, workplace technologies, security, and automation. •Proven leadership, communication, and stakeholder management skills. •Strategic thinker who translates technical challenges into business solutions. •Financially savvy, collaborative, and solution-oriented. •Willingness to travel and participate in an emergency out-of-hours rota. Benefits for the role: Competitive salary, generous annual bonus, Life Assurance, Private Medical Insurance, 25 days holiday plus bank holidays (rising with service), Enhanced Maternity & Paternity Family Leave, Enhanced Bereavement Leave, Pension Employer Contribution Scheme (matched up to 8%), Exclusive access to Müller Rewards, offering a variety of online and in-store discounts and development opportunities.
